Poem in A Bottle

September 4, 2011

My words are of love to you, sealed away for the rest of time,
Even though they won't help get you out of my mind.

I roll the paper up and slowly slide it in,
Reminiscing of all our times way back when.

I cork the bottle to preserve our love,
Something that once was.

I tie a gold ribbon around the bottle's neck,
No need for such fancy decorations, but what the heck.

Perhaps one day, my poem will drift to shore
And someone will read of the love I wanted forever more.

The clean and crisp paper will then be old,
But my story will still be told.

The bottle will be dirty,
The poem inside will show I'm hurting.

A long lost message of what our love could have been
If only we had tried harder back then.

The chances of you ever reading this poem are slim to none,
But I still want you to know you are the one.

I kneel down in the sand,
A strong wave washes the bottle from my hand.

Something I thought was always meant to be...
But all that's left is this poem in a bottle, written by me.
